Pontefract Steam in the Snow
Although
I cannot be entirely certain, it is very likely that this is the
Knottingley - Wakefield train referred to in the previous photograph,
and taken later that same morning but looking in the opposite direction
towards the station buildings. The locomotive is basically of the same
design as the previous one but is the tank engine version as distinct
from the tendered version. Originally, the L.M.S. Railway differentiated
their classifications as 2F and 2P to indicate freight and passenger
usage but this was later abbreviated to 2 without distinction. The
locomotives are 46437 and 41251. Peter
Cookson.
